I work in a garage, and these things brake down a lot, and they are not cheap to fix either. I had one where the blower motor died, to get to it you had to take the dashboard out (different modle) and it was a 9 hour job R&R. plus the part was 2 weeks away because it came from England. It was about $2000 to fix the blower motor. I would personally advise against it because of thier track record and poor mechanic construction. In my opinion, they are a cheap quality vehicle for what is paid for them. The only land rovers worth buying were the original one used in desert locations.
